After a year and a half, on 12/3 the FCC granted K31GL's application to move from RF 31 to RF 33. Their situation is now similar to KJJM.
In their applications both stations claimed adjacent-channel interference (from KDAF and KDFW, respectively), but the proposed displacements also involve antenna changes that would reduce their coverage more than the ACI I expect either is receiving, so I suspect that ACI was mostly a lame excuse. (To be fair, K31GL's application also includes a power increase to 15 kW, the maximum for UHF LPTV.)
I doubt either station will actually move at this point, since both seem to be doing fine at their current frequencies. But we'll see.
